Review Comment:
   This needs a bit of history.... originally Maven had no means to (re)use 
Resolver transport to fetch (or put) non "standard" (not on layout) resources, 
and similarly, you could not reuse cache/checksum policies to perform such a 
transport, youd need to redo everything. As everything was either artifact or 
maven metadata. But with latest Resolver, metadata URI is calculated like this:
   
   Metadata is G, A, V and T. Remote URI is constructed as:
   * remote repository `baseUrl`
   * if G given, `+G.replaceAll(".", "/")` -- as artifact groupId
   * if A given, `+A` -- as artifact artifactId
   * if V given, `+V` -- as artifact version
   * `+type`
   
   Type was always "maven-metadata.xml". This is how you can make Resolver 
download the Maven Repository Metadata from G (plugin) level, GA (versions) 
level, and GAV (snapshot resolution) level.
   
   Later, we realized that type does not have to be always 
"maven-metadata.xml", but can be something else, so for example Archetype 
Catalog (that sits in [repo 
root](https://repo.maven.apache.org/maven2/archetype-catalog.xml)) can be 
addressed (and hence, use same transport to get artifacts) as this (this is how 
it is done in m-archetype-p to get and cache the catalog):
   
   `Metadata(G:"", A:"", V:"", Type:"archetype-catalog.xml")` and is cached 
locally as `archetype-catalog-$repoID.xml` (w/ checksums) by Resolver 
automatically (this is how "metadata" is handled by resolver).
   
   The subsequent step was to make `Metadata` be able to address **any (out of 
layout) file** on remote repository, or, in other words, make Maven able to get 
any file (and cache it, with all the whistle and bells of 
caching/policies/checksums) that are not addressable by GAV/artifact. This 
change was done in https://github.com/apache/maven-resolver/pull/1491 and it 
was needed for prefixes (again, to use same transport and all features of local 
repo like checksum validation/cache retention/etc and maven metadata tracking 
by origin). Basically prefix files lie on this path:
   
   `Metadata(G:"", A:"", V:"", Type:".meta/prefixes.txt")` and is cached 
locally as `.meta/prefixes-$repoId.txt` (w/ checksums) by resolver 
automatically.
   
   And currently, they are the ONLY Metadata files (in resolver and/or maven) 
that contain `/` (slash).
